Topic:Hemodynamics

Hemodynamics in horses refers to the study of blood flow and the forces involved in circulation within the equine cardiovascular system. It encompasses the examination of heart function, blood pressure, and the distribution of blood to various tissues and organs. Key parameters in equine hemodynamics include cardiac output, vascular resistance, and blood volume. These factors are integral to understanding how horses respond to exercise, stress, and various health conditions. Pulmonary artery wedge pressure measurement in healthy warmblood horses and in warmblood horses with mitral valve insufficiencies of various degrees during standardised treadmill exercise.
Research in veterinary science    July 28, 2004   Volume 77, Issue 3 257-264 doi: 10.1016/j.rvsc.2004.04.009
Gehlen H, Bubeck K, Stadler P.In 12 healthy warmblood horses and 10 horses with mitral valve insufficiencies (MVI) of various degrees heart rate and pulmonary artery wedge pressure (PWP) was measured at rest and during standardised exercise on a high speed treadmill. There was a significant increase in PWP with each change in speed of the treadmill (p < 0.01). The PWP of horses with mild mitral valve regurgitation under working conditions was not significantly different compared to the healthy horses.
